I chose the consistently amazing Battersea Decorative & Antiques Fair to launch my new venture as a dealer in postwar Czech glass design, which I still believe is a hugely under-rated area. I’m standing with Lalique, Gallé and Daum specialist dealers M&D Moir, and I have to say that amidst all the decorative delights, our stand is ablaze with colour!
My stock includes designs by many of the great names in postwar Czech glass design, from Frantisek Vizner to Jiri Suhajek, Vladimir Zahour, Pavel Hlava, Frantisek Koudelka, Hana Machovska, and more. I’m particularly delighted with a selection of five flashed and cut vases designed by Ladislav Oliva in 1968, one of which is seen above.
